1. Sold
    3/11/25
    32 photos

    Sold Townhouse
    4405 O Street, PHILADELPHIA, PA

    $305,000

  2. Sold
    3/11/25
    20 photos

    Sold Townhouse
    4329 Howland Street, PHILADELPHIA, PA

    $182,500

  3. Sold
    3/6/25
    23 photos

    Sold Townhouse
    3925 Claridge Street, PHILADELPHIA, PA

    $165,000

  4. Sold
    2/28/25
    46 photos

    Sold Townhouse
    4200 Palmetto Street, PHILADELPHIA, PA

    $305,000

  5. Sold
    2/28/25
    14 photos

    Sold Townhouse
    4319 O Street, PHILADELPHIA, PA

    $210,000

  6. Sold
    2/28/25
    21 photos

    Sold Townhouse
    3910 L Street, PHILADELPHIA, PA

    $180,000

  7. Sold
    2/24/25
    37 photos

    Sold Townhouse
    4122 Lawndale Street, PHILADELPHIA, PA

    $160,000

  8. Sold
    2/21/25
    27 photos

    Sold Townhouse
    4010 K Street, PHILADELPHIA, PA

    $255,000

  9. Sold
    2/21/25
    28 photos

    Sold Townhouse
    4235 Bennington Street, PHILADELPHIA, PA

    $230,000

  10. Sold
    2/21/25
    25 photos

    Sold Townhouse
    4617 Shelbourne Street, PHILADELPHIA, PA

    $215,000

  11. Sold
    2/13/25
    12 photos

    Sold Townhouse
    4327 Claridge Street, PHILADELPHIA, PA

    $165,000

  12. Sold
    2/11/25
    8 photos

    Sold Townhouse
    4040 Lawndale Street, PHILADELPHIA, PA

    $140,000

  13. Sold
    2/7/25
    33 photos

    Sold Townhouse
    3944 Dungan Street, PHILADELPHIA, PA

    $140,000

  14. Sold
    1/23/25
    12 photos

    Sold Townhouse
    4036 M Street, PHILADELPHIA, PA

    $205,000

  15. Sold
    1/17/25
    50 photos

    Sold Townhouse
    1937 Buckius Street, PHILADELPHIA, PA

    $85,000

  • End of Results
  • No homes match your search. Try resetting your search criteria.

    Reset search